Building a Semantic Digital Ecosystem
FocusZen® Labs Ltd was not originally designed as a traditional technology company.
What began as a relatively simple productivity application gradually evolved into a multi-layered digital ecosystem connecting productivity systems, cognitive audio, educational interaction models, semantic web structures and AI-era branding architecture.
The foundation of the entire system is based on one principle:
Modern digital environments are no longer interpreted only by humans.They are increasingly interpreted by artificial intelligence systems.
Because of this, FocusZen® Labs was intentionally developed not as isolated products, but as an interconnected semantic network where every layer supports and strengthens the contextual understanding of the whole ecosystem.
The current structure consists of:
A productivity and organisational environment designed around calm technology, neurodiversity-oriented structure and cognitive clarity. The system focuses on reducing digital overwhelm while supporting focus, emotional balance and everyday organisation.
An experimental cognitive audio environment combining AI-assisted music, spoken-word structures, deep focus atmospheres and emotionally driven sound architecture. The project explores how sound, rhythm and semantic identity can influence perception, concentration and digital behaviour.
An educational gamification layer designed around interaction, memory activation, reflex training and cognitive engagement. The system introduces playful educational mechanics into the wider FocusZen® ecosystem.
